Marc Spears of Yahoo! with a nice feature on Russell Westbrook: “Sonics/Thunder assistant general manager Troy Weaver continued to push strongly for Westbrook, whom he felt best fit the franchise with his combination of talent, character and work ethic. Weaver, Sonics general manager Sam Presti said, had a “passion about Russell’s ability to grow with the organization over time.” The pitch paid off: The Sonics took Westbrook No. 4.”

KD still second for MVP in ESPN’s Award Watch: “OKC is 14-3 in its past 17. Durant has showed improvement on defense while becoming arguably the top scoring threat in the league. His lone negative is turnovers.”

Benson Taylor of Sporting News: “Earlier this season, as recent as late January, the Thunder were one of several teams fighting for the eighth spot in the West. Then came February, when OKC lost only two games, putting the team well above .500 and well on pace to make the playoffs. Now, the Thunder are one of the teams that the Hornets, Rockets and Grizzlies—who are all scrambling to get back in playoff position—are gunning for.”

Jax Raging Bile Duct :After reading the article, it has some to do with what I thought. Most of the legit assists are in transition, or an entry pass to the post. The set plays they run off the high ball screen are being credited as an assist even though the scorer is making basketball moves after the pass in order to create a score.
Those transition assists should be in every point guards resume. Kudos to Collison for that. Too many young PG’s don’t know how to handle transition well.
Collison and Paul are talented enough to get those alley-oop type assists, where they command so much attention getting to the bucket that a quick alley-oop to the rolling big works wonders.

im not saying collison is bad, i even said he would start on a lot of teams. Durant helps RW somewhat, but not as much as west and okafor help collison. Durant has a 50.7% assisted rate, and shoots 47.6%.

West shoots 49.3% and has 56.1% assisted, okafor shoots 53% and has a 67.7% assisted% they combine for roughly the same number of points as durant and shoot less free throws, so more of their points are assisted.

If westbrook had bigs like them he would be getting 10 assists a game.
